On a related theme - Dr. Deborah Doxtator authored an important paper on
the First Nations and Museums as part of the Royal Commission on
Aboriginal Peoples in the mid 1990s, which in part addresses and responds
to the (Canadian) Task Force Report Tim McShane mentions. The Commission
report is published (paper and cd), though it can be somewhat hard to
access south of the border.
